How much do administrative support coordinator j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 4, 2026, the average hourly pay for administrative support coordinator in Decatur, AL is $19.63,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.12 and $21.88 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an administrative support coordinator?

Administrative Support Coordinators are professionals who provide organizational and administrative assistance within an office or department. Their responsibilities typically include managing schedules, handling correspondence, organizing meetings, maintaining records, and ensuring smooth office operations. They serve as a key point of contact between staff, management, and external parties. Strong organizational and communication skills are essential for success in this role. Administrative Support Coordinators play a vital role in helping offices function efficiently and effectively.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an administrative support coordinator?

To thrive as an Administrative Support Coordinator,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and proficiency in office administration, often supported by a relevant associate’s or bachelor’s degree. Familiarity with office software like Microsoft Office Suite, calendar management systems, and sometimes knowledge of project management tools are typically required. Excellent communication, multitasking, and problem-solving abilities help you effectively support teams and handle various priorities. These skills ensure smooth office operations, enhance productivity, and contribute to overall workplace efficiency.

What are some common challenges administrative support coordinators face, and how can they effectively manage them?

Administrative Support Coordinators often juggle multiple tasks such as scheduling, document management, and communication across departments, which can lead to competing priorities and tight deadlines. Effective time management, clear communication, and strong organizational skills are crucial for handling these challenges. Many coordinators find success by using digital tools to streamline workflows and by proactively clarifying priorities with supervisors and colleagues. Building good relationships with team members also helps in resolving issues quickly and maintaining a positive work environment.

How much do administrative support coordinators make in the US?

Administrative Support Coordinators in the US typically earn a median annual salary of around $40,000 to $50,000, depending on experience, location, and industry. Entry-level positions may start lower, while experienced coordinators with specialized skills can earn higher wages, often supplemented by benefits and opportunities for advancement.
